Re: Mercedes Benz Thread by beholddean: 6:26pm On Nov 26, 2014
Great Benz enthusiasts, I need your help. I drive a GL 450..Yesterday, while I was in traffic, the engine just stopped. I managed to restart the SUV after a couple of trials. However, the movement was not smooth. It kept stalling and would not rev. It was like it would stop again any minute. I managed to get it home sha. By that time, the check engine light had come on. I used my Launch scanner and it picked P2006 (intake manifold stuck open - bank 1) as well as P0300 (several cylinder misfires) .Has anybody had this issue before? Also, the SUV is kindda bouncy now. Not too bad but noticeable. My suspension is.suspect. Please share your experience and views with me. Its my first Benz and barely 3months old. Guess I got an unpleasant baptism with Benz.
Re: Mercedes Benz Thread by auhanson(m): 1:05am On Nov 27, 2014
beholddean:
Great Benz enthusiasts, I need your help. I drive a GL 450..Yesterday, while I was in traffic, the engine just stopped. I managed to restart the SUV after a couple of trials. However, the movement was not smooth. It kept stalling and would not rev. It was like it would stop again any minute. I managed to get it home sha. By that time, the check engine light had come on. I used my Launch scanner and it picked P2006 (intake manifold stuck open - bank 1) as well as P0300 (several cylinder misfires) .Has anybody had this issue before? Also, the SUV is kindda bouncy now. Not too bad but noticeable. My suspension is.suspect. Please share your experience and views with me. Its my first Benz and barely 3months old. Guess I got an unpleasant baptism with Benz.
Don't panic. This is no issue. Its a fuel system problem. If u we're using premium fuel or extreme fuel treatment, it wouldn't have happen in the first place. Just do a thorough cleaning/replacing of your plugs, clean up your throttle body, nuzzle etc and all will be well. After then make sure you use Xft/ premium fuel for your car to completely clear this and to avoid future occurrence.

Re: Mercedes Benz Thread by Nobody: 8:03pm On Nov 27, 2014
Eyop:


auhanson is correct my brother and for sure,the problem you experienced is fuel related and nothing more. I have experienced same some years ago so just follow his advice. Is your GL450 suspension airmatic?

I would Advise you go to Konga and Jumia and get extreme fuel treatment I'm even surprised you drive the car in that condition.

Check your tyre pressure and hope they well inflated. The tyre pressure is on the door panel don't listen to the Vulcanizers that insists on 50 and 60 PSI.

Also check your power steering fluid often the GL is known for chewing it's steering rack another expensive fix.
